Current and Resistance
LEDs have a specific current rating. If the current flowing through the LED is too high, it can burn out the LED. That's where resistors come in. Some 3mm LED 12V products, like the 3mm Green Led Inside Resister 12v, already have a built - in resistor. This resistor helps to limit the current flowing through the LED, keeping it within a safe range.
If you're using an LED without a built - in resistor, you'll need to add an external resistor. You can calculate the value of the resistor using Ohm's law (V = IR), where V is the voltage, I is the current, and R is the resistance. For example, if your LED has a forward voltage drop of 2V and a recommended current of 20mA (0.02A), and you're using a 12V power supply, the voltage across the resistor will be 12V - 2V = 10V. Using Ohm's law, R = V / I, so the resistance of the external resistor should be 10V / 0.02A = 500 ohms.

Advantages of Using 3mm LED 12V in Power Bank Indicators
There are several advantages to using a 3mm LED 12V in a power bank indicator. One of the main advantages is their small size. They don't take up much space, which is great for power banks that are designed to be compact.
They're also energy - efficient. LEDs consume less power compared to traditional incandescent bulbs, which means they won't drain the power bank's battery quickly.
And they have a long lifespan. LEDs can last for thousands of hours, so you won't have to worry about replacing the indicator light frequently.
Potential Challenges
However, there are also some potential challenges. One challenge is that if the power bank's voltage fluctuates, it can affect the performance of the LED. For example, if the voltage goes too high, it can damage the LED. To overcome this, you can use a voltage regulator to keep the voltage stable.
Another challenge is that soldering a small 3mm LED can be tricky. You need to have some basic soldering skills to ensure a good connection.
